National Women's Health Week and National Women's Checkup Day Sun May 8 is Mothers Day and also kicks off the 12th annual National Women's Health Week and National Women's Checkup Day, Mon May 9. "It's Your Time!" is the theme for the 2011 National Women's Health Week. This week-long national health observance empowers women to make their health a top priority. It also encourages them to take steps to improve their physical and mental health and lower their risks of certain diseases. Although Medicare is now helping to pay for more preventive services and screenings, many women with Medicare are not taking full advantage of them, leaving significant gaps in prevention. Medicare Coverage: Medicare provides coverage of many preventive services and screenings that are especially meaningful to women, including but not limited to: § Bone Mass Measurements § Cancer Screenings o Breast (Mammogram and Clinical Breast Exam) o Cervical and Vaginal (Pap Test and Pelvic Exam) o Colorectal § Cardiovascular Disease Screenings § Diabetes Screening § HIV Screening § Immunizations o Hepatitis B o Influenza o Pneumococcal § Tobacco Use Cessation Counseling § Yearly Wellness Exam (New for 2011) Note: While coverage by Medicare is subject to certain eligibility criteria, many preventive services and screenings can now be received with no out-of-pocket costs to the beneficiary.
